After a weak second week so far, Day 13 once again showed that the film is struggling to attract audiences to theatres. The overall trend clearly indicates that interest in the film is fading by the day.

On Day 13 (Wednesday), Kis Kisko Pyaar Karoon 2 is estimated to have collected around ₹0.35–0.45 crore at the Indian box office. These numbers are slightly lower than Day 12 and in line with the usual midweek drop seen for films without strong word of mouth. Occupancy levels remained low in multiplexes, while single-screen theatres contributed limited business.

Total Box Office Collection Till Day 13
After 13 days of its theatrical run, Kis Kisko Pyaar Karoon 2 has collected approximately ₹16.6–16.8 crore at the Indian box office. The pace of earnings has slowed down significantly, with daily numbers adding only marginally to the total. Compared with expectations for a sequel, the overall performance so far has been below average.

Budget and Recovery Status

The film is made on an estimated budget of ₹35–40 crore, including production and promotional costs. Given current box-office trends, it is clear that the film is far from recouping its investment through theatrical collections alone. Even if collections remain steady at low levels for a few more days, the final lifetime total is expected to stay well below the film’s budget.

Because of this, the makers are expected to rely heavily on OTT streaming rights, satellite television rights, and music deals to recover a significant portion of the remaining costs. These non-theatrical revenues will play an important role in balancing the film’s overall business.
